What is Data Integration and Modeling (ETL/ELT)?
The quality of your reports depends on the quality of the data underneath. If each source says one thing and the data is dirty or duplicated, no dashboard will be reliable. That is why the work of integration and modeling is the foundation of Business Intelligence.
We design and implement ETL/ELT processes that extract data from your sources (ERP, CRM, Excel, databases, APIs), clean and transform it, and load it into a coherent data model. We use tools such as Azure Data Factory, Microsoft Fabric, and SQL, creating a dimensional model optimized for analysis.
The result is a single source of truth, with clean, consistent, and organized data, on which your reports and dashboards run fast and reliable.

Features of Data Integration and Modeling (ETL/ELT)
Data Extraction (E)
Connection and reading of data from ERP, CRM, databases, APIs, CSV/Excel files and cloud services.
Transformation (T)
Cleansing, validation, normalization, calculations, and business rules to turn raw data into reliable information.
Load (L)
Write the transformed data to the Power BI data warehouse, data lakehouse, or semantic model.
Dimensional modeling
Design of fact and dimension tables (star schema, snowflake) optimized for analysis and reporting.
Azure Data Factory
Orchestration of data pipelines in the cloud with native connectors, triggers, and monitoring.
Microsoft Fabric Dataflows
Low-code transformations within the Fabric ecosystem for scenarios that require unified governance.
Data quality
Validation rules, anomaly detection, and alerts when data does not meet defined standards.
Model documentation
Dictionary of data, lineage, and documentation of each table, field, and metric for maintainability.
